Ibuprofen Dosing for Adults

For most adults with acute pain, ibuprofen 400 mg every 4-6 hours is the optimal starting dose, with a maximum daily limit of 2400 mg, and treatment should not exceed 5-10 days without mandatory monitoring. 1, 2

Standard Dosing Regimens

Acute Pain Management

  • 400-800 mg every 4-6 hours for acute pain conditions 3, 1, 4
  • Maximum single dose: 800 mg 3, 1
  • Maximum daily dose: 2400 mg (avoid exceeding this limit) 3, 1, 2
  • The FDA-approved maximum is 3200 mg daily for prescription use in chronic inflammatory conditions like rheumatoid arthritis, but this higher dose carries significantly increased risks and requires close monitoring 2

Duration of Treatment

  • Limit acute pain treatment to 5-10 days maximum without instituting mandatory monitoring protocols 1
  • If pain persists beyond 2 weeks, investigate for underlying treatable causes rather than continuing ibuprofen 1
  • For chronic use beyond 2 weeks, mandatory monitoring every 3 months is required 1

High-Risk Populations Requiring Dose Modification or Avoidance

Absolute Contraindications

  • Active peptic ulcer disease 3, 4
  • Severe renal impairment (creatinine clearance <10-30 mL/min) 4
  • Aspirin/NSAID-induced asthma 3, 1
  • Perioperative pain in coronary artery bypass graft surgery 1

Relative Contraindications Requiring Extreme Caution

  • Age >60 years: Start with lower doses (400 mg every 6 hours) due to 5-fold increased risk of serious adverse events 3, 1, 4
  • Heart failure or cardiovascular disease: Use lowest effective dose for shortest duration; consider alternative analgesics 3, 1, 4
  • Chronic kidney disease: Avoid in moderate-to-severe impairment; consider acetaminophen instead 3, 1
  • History of peptic ulcer disease: 5% risk of recurrent bleeding within 6 months even with protective measures 1
  • Concomitant anticoagulant use: Increases GI bleeding risk 5-6 fold 1
  • Hypertension: Monitor blood pressure closely as NSAIDs can worsen control 1
  • Concurrent corticosteroid or SSRI use: Significantly increases GI bleeding risk 3

Gastrointestinal Protection Strategies

All patients taking ibuprofen chronically (>2 weeks) should receive gastroprotection with a proton pump inhibitor or misoprostol, particularly those with risk factors 3, 1. The one-year risk of serious GI bleeding ranges from 1 in 2,100 in adults <45 years to 1 in 110 in adults >75 years 1.

Critical Drug Interactions

Aspirin Interference

If taking low-dose aspirin for cardioprotection, ibuprofen must be taken at least 30 minutes AFTER immediate-release aspirin or at least 8 hours BEFORE aspirin to avoid blocking aspirin's antiplatelet effects 3, 4. This interaction can negate aspirin's cardiovascular protection 3.

Multiple NSAID Use

Never combine ibuprofen with another NSAID (including naproxen, ketorolac, or COX-2 inhibitors), as this increases toxicity without additional benefit 3

Mandatory Monitoring for Extended Use (>2 weeks)

If ibuprofen use extends beyond 2 weeks, monitor every 3 months 1:

  • Blood pressure 1
  • BUN and creatinine 1
  • Liver function tests 1
  • Complete blood count 1
  • Fecal occult blood 1

Immediate Discontinuation Criteria

Stop ibuprofen immediately if any of the following occur 1:

  • BUN or creatinine doubles
  • Hypertension develops or worsens
  • Liver function tests increase above normal limits
  • Any signs of GI bleeding (melena, hematemesis, positive fecal occult blood)
  • Acute kidney injury signs (decreased urine output, rising creatinine, fluid retention)

Alternative Strategies for High-Risk Patients

Safer First-Line Options

  • Acetaminophen up to 3000-4000 mg daily is safer in patients with renal impairment, cardiovascular disease, or GI risk factors, though potentially less effective 3, 1, 4
  • Topical NSAIDs (diclofenac gel) for localized musculoskeletal pain minimize systemic exposure 3, 1

When to Escalate Therapy

If pain persists despite maximum-dose ibuprofen (2400 mg/day) for 5-10 days 1:

  • Consider adding gabapentin or pregabalin for neuropathic pain components 1
  • Transition to multimodal analgesia rather than increasing NSAID dose 1
  • Consider weak opioids combined with acetaminophen per WHO Step II ladder 4

Common Pitfalls to Avoid

  • Hidden NSAID sources: Account for ibuprofen in combination medications (e.g., with hydrocodone) to avoid exceeding maximum daily doses 3, 1
  • Prolonged use without reassessment: The risk-benefit ratio deteriorates significantly after 2 weeks of continuous use 1, 4
  • Inadequate gastroprotection: Even short-term use in high-risk patients warrants proton pump inhibitor co-administration 3, 1
  • Ignoring renal function: NSAIDs are dose-dependently nephrotoxic, particularly in volume-depleted states 3, 5
  • Combining with other NSAIDs: This is a common error that dramatically increases toxicity without improving efficacy 3

Efficacy Considerations

Research demonstrates that ibuprofen 400 mg is as effective as aspirin 600-900 mg and superior to acetaminophen for moderate pain, with a duration of action of at least 6 hours 6. Doses above 400 mg provide minimal additional analgesia for acute pain but significantly increase adverse event risk 2, 6. At OTC doses (≤1200 mg/day), ibuprofen has the lowest GI toxicity risk among NSAIDs and comparable safety to acetaminophen 7, 8.
